2 Room Cheap New Apartment For Sale In Mahmutlar Alanya Turkey Rcm 2605 1 Alanya RealEstate 26/05/20250 Comments2 Room Cheap New Apartment For Sale In Mahmutlar Alanya Turkey Rcm 2605 1 Share Link Post navigation Prev2 Room Cheap New Apartment for sale in Mahmutlar Alanya Turkey -RCM-2605